Welcome to the official website of the Welsh branch of the Young Communist League, the youth organisation of the Communist Party of Britain.

Founded in 1921, we are a revolutionary Marxist-Leninist organisation that advocates for the establishment of a socialist society in Wales and Britain as a whole.

We apply Communist theories and practice, many of which are summed up in our programme Britain’s Road to Socialism, to organise and campaign effectively to overthrow state monopoly capitalism and transform Britain into a socialist society based on common ownership, democratic control, full equality, universal access to public services, environmental protection and advancement for the human race.

With members across the country, we actively engage in demonstrations, community work and direct action in communities across Wales to fight for the interests of working people and marginalised minorities.